Screen Glue stuck on BBC exec

Screen Glue, the UK indie founded by Wide-Eyed Entertainment co-founder Jasper James, has added an executive from the BBC to its development team.

Development exec and executive producer Will Aslett has joined the team to work alongside James on the company’s unscripted slate.

Aslett was previously international lead for BBC History and Business, developing coproductions that included Royal Wives at War and How Hip Hop Conquered the World.

Prior to that he was part of the BBC Science team, executive producing Pompeii: The Mystery of the Bodies Frozen in Time, among others.

Aslett had an earlier spell with the BBC’s specialist factual department in the 1990s and then went on to produce National Geographic’s long-running series Naked Science at Pioneer Productions. He also worked at Impossible Pictures, where he first met James.

James founded Screen Glue in 2013 to create scripted and unscripted content, including recent kids’ drama Quarx and animated history series Lost Lands.
